[quarterly report on Mines] Glencore: cut nickel production guidance for the whole year of 2020 to 122kt by 2 per cent

Published: Apr 30, 2020 18:01

SMM4, March 30: today, Glencore released its first quarter 2020 results, showing that its operations at the LaGlen nickel mine in Quebec, Canada, ceased in late March. It is now restarted and is in progress. Affect output for less than a month. The Koniobo nickel project in New Caledonia extended the planned maintenance downtime of one production line (two) and delayed the restart time by approximately two months.

Production guidelines for the whole of 2020:

Nickel: 122kt of its own nickel production guidance, down 3kt (- 2 per cent) from the previously announced quota production guidance, mainly reflecting the mandatory temporary suspension of production in Raglan (Quebec).

Production situation:

Production of own nickel was 28200 tons, an increase of 1100 tons (+ 4 per cent) over the first quarter of 2019, reflecting the impact of interruptions in the INO and Koniambo base periods and MurrinMurrin maintenance during the current period.

The production of (INO):-owned nickel in the nickel integrated operation was 14600 tons, an increase of 1200 tons (+ 9 per cent) over the first quarter of 2019, reflecting the impact of severe weather on transport and logistics during the benchmark period. Production was broadly consistent with the more comparable fourth quarter of 2019.

Murrin Murrin: 's own nickel production was 7600 tons, a decrease of 1100 tons (- 13 per cent) from the first quarter of 2019, mainly reflecting the maintenance shutdown in February.

Koniambo: nickel production was 6000 tons, an increase of 1000 tons (+ 20 per cent) over the first quarter of 2019, reflecting various disturbances during the base period.
